Sounds like you have been assigned a seat in the first row of Euro Traveller. The port side pair at the front of the cabin are arguably the most popular seats in the cabin but selecting these in advance comes with a health warning. As the curtain may move forward or back depending on loading, you may find yourself evicted at the eleventh hour and reassigned a seat elsewhere.
Row 9 is the overwing exit row.
